One of the most impressive and distinctive features of the red deer are the аntlers. Only the stags have antlers. Antlers typically measure 71 cm in total length and weigh 1 kg although large ones can grow to 115 cm and weigh 5 kg Antlers are made of bone.

Primula Palinuri (Petagna) is endemic to some parts of the Tyrrhenian Lucanian limestone coasts (southern Campania and Basilicata ) and Calabrian. It is 15-20 cm high and formed by pendulous, gold-yellow flowers, whose calices are powdery and white, blooming between February and March.
